Today we are excited to announce our newest location -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ia!

The first ever Kuala Lumpur Founder Institute is just around the corner, as the 4-month program is slated to start on 1 April, 2013. The program is open to existing and prospective technology founders of all kinds - with or without an idea, young or old, and with a full-time job or unemployed.

The Founder Institute is an early-stage startup accelerator and global launch network that, in just three years of operation, has helped launch over 750 companies across 40 cities and five continents. Through our part-time four month program, existing and prospective founders can launch their dream company with expert training, feedback, and support from experienced startup CEOs - while not being required to quit their day job. Our unique Graduate Liquidity Pool also enables graduates and mentors to share in the equity upside of each class, creating strong teamwork-based startup ecosystems where great companies can flourish. We call it "Globalizing Silicon Valley."

There are many reasons why the Founder Institute is setting up in Kuala Lumpur. Kuala Lumpur is a vibrant city with a nascent entrepreneurship community centered around the fastest growing region in Malaysia. With just less than 3 hours flight to other major cities in the Southeast Asia region, Kuala Lumpur serves as an ideal inter-connecting hub in Asia.

A low cost of living, multilingual workforces, and access to a huge technical talent pool make it an ideal place for launching a global startup.

The Kuala Lumpur chapter will be led by Heislyc Loh and Tzu Ming Chu. Heislyc is the Founder of StartupMamak, a community of startups who meetup monthly and Tzu Ming is the Founder & CEO of Impersuasion.com, a web analytics software and solutions firm.
